Account recovery, consent-banner edition. If you get locked out of the Mossbridge rollout console mid-deploy (happens more than you'd think — the session store resets when the banner config flips regions), don't panic and don't re-trigger the rollout. Pause the flag in Fernwick first, then recover your account through the break-glass flow. It'll ask for the team recovery phrase before letting you back in. Type the passphrase below exactly as written.

unlock words, taguf-yafop: quenwyn-druox

RELEASE CHECKLIST — Crumbport order-cutoff rule. Verify the 2pm cutoff enforces against store-local time, not server time; the Millbrae pilot shipped with UTC and accepted late orders for a week. Confirm the grace-period flag defaults to off and that queued orders placed before cutoff still bake out. Future maintainers: if you change the cutoff hour, update the customer banner copy too, or support gets flooded. The validated build is recorded below.

pipeline stamp: htk3_a71

Welcome aboard! One thing you'll bump into early is Sweepline, our data-retention sweeper. It runs nightly, finds records past their retention window, and soft-deletes them in batches so we don't hammer the primary. If it falls behind you'll see alerts in the ops channel — usually it just needs a restart. To inspect what Sweepline is about to purge, connect to the retention database with the string below.

database URL for kawig-hahog: mongodb://ulador_svc:aF4YK3bpHxBm2h@db-6f0d.ferrahq.corp:5432/druox